사용자 정의 WordPress 테마를 빠르게 반복하는 방법

게시 됨: 2022-11-02

WordPress 개발자라면 언젠가는 사용자 정의 테마를 만들어야 할 가능성이 큽니다. 그리고 사용자 지정 테마를 생성해야 했다면 변경, 기능 추가 등을 반복해야 할 가능성이 높습니다. 사용자 지정 WordPress 테마 를 반복하는 것은 특히 다음과 같은 경우 약간 지루할 수 있습니다. 많은 변화를 일으키고 있습니다. 이 기사에서는 변경 사항을 최대한 빨리 적용할 수 있도록 사용자 지정 WordPress 테마를 빠르게 반복하는 방법을 보여줍니다.

WordPress 테마를 어떻게 조작합니까?

출처: slidesharecdn.com

모양으로 이동하여 선택하십시오. WordPress 관리자 패널의 사이드바에는 테마 모음이 포함되어 있습니다. 이 페이지의 지침은 사용하려는 WordPress 테마 위에 마우스 커서를 놓고 활성화 버튼을 클릭하여 선택하도록 지시합니다. 웹사이트의 홈페이지로 이동하여 새 테마 가 설치된 모습을 확인하세요.

WordPress 테마를 올바른 방법으로 수정하려면 간단한 자습서를 따르는 것이 좋습니다. 이 기사에서는 WordPress Child Themes에서 모듈식 CSS를 사용하는 방법을 살펴보겠습니다. 주제 테마의 모듈식 CSS를 기반으로 하는 Chiron이라는 하위 테마 를 만들 것입니다. Filter Hooks는 WordPress에서 강력한 편집을 만드는 데 사용할 수 있습니다. 이것을 사용하면 WordPress 테마가 생성하는 HTML을 거의 확실히 제어할 수 있습니다. 이 게시물에서는 PHP 함수에서 Action Hook을 사용하는 방법과 이를 사용하여 PHP 함수를 작성하는 방법을 배웁니다.

사용자 정의 WordPress 테마를 만드는 데 얼마나 걸립니까?

사용자 정의 WordPress 테마를 빌드하는 데 걸리는 시간은 디자인의 복잡성, 필요한 기능 및 개발자의 경험 수준에 따라 크게 다를 수 있으므로 이 질문에 대한 모든 정답은 없습니다. 그러나 일반적으로 사용자 정의 WordPress 테마를 처음부터 빌드하는 데 일반적으로 몇 주에서 몇 달이 걸립니다.

Siamcomputing은 자신의 WordPress 테마 개발과 관련된 단계를 안내합니다. 브랜드 요구 사항에 맞게 특별히 맞춤화된 WordPress 개발은 다양한 이점을 제공합니다. 결과적으로 대부분의 테마에는 사용하지 않을 것 같은 많은 기능이 포함되어 있으므로 코드베이스를 간결하게 유지할 수 있습니다. 버튼, 제목, 글꼴, 앵커 링크, 글머리 기호 및 번호 매기기 목록 등과 같은 웹 사이트의 공통 요소에 대한 기본 디자인은 UI 키트에서 찾을 수 있습니다. 이 작업은 2~3일 안에 완료할 수 있습니다. 그런 다음 와이어프레임과 스타일 가이드를 UI 키트와 결합하여 최종 구성을 만듭니다. 이 작업을 완료하는 데 1~2주가 소요될 것으로 예상됩니다. 올바른 단계와 최고 품질의 맞춤형 사이트를 구축하려면 완전한 기능의 WordPress 테마를 만드는 데 4-6주가 소요됩니다. 우리는 전 세계의 고객을 위해 150개 이상의 맞춤형 WordPress 사이트를 구축했습니다. 따라서 우리가 당신을 도울 수 있는지 궁금하다면 포트폴리오를 확인하고 이메일을 보내주십시오.

WordPress 테마를 어떻게 추적합니까?

WordPress 테마를 추적하려면 내장 테마 편집기 를 사용할 수 있습니다. 이렇게 하면 어떤 파일이 변경되었고 어떤 파일이 여전히 동일한지 확인할 수 있습니다. WP Migrate DB와 같은 플러그인을 사용하여 WordPress 데이터베이스의 변경 사항을 추적할 수도 있습니다.

더 긴 WordPress 테마 개발

WordPress의 인기가 계속 높아짐에 따라 점점 더 많은 개발자가 플랫폼용 테마를 만드는 데 관심이 있습니다. 개발 프로세스의 속도를 높이는 데 사용할 수 있는 기존 테마 프레임워크 가 많이 있지만 많은 개발자는 처음부터 사용자 지정 테마를 만드는 것을 선호합니다. 사용자 지정 WordPress 테마를 만드는 것은 특히 처음부터 시작하는 경우 시간이 오래 걸릴 수 있습니다. 테마의 전체적인 모양과 느낌을 디자인하는 것 외에도 테마를 구동하는 템플릿과 기능을 코딩해야 합니다. 코딩에 익숙하지 않은 경우 이는 어려운 작업일 수 있습니다. 그러나 책, 온라인 자습서 및 커뮤니티 포럼을 포함하여 시작하는 데 도움이 되는 다양한 리소스가 있습니다. 첫 번째 사용자 지정 WordPress 테마를 만든 후에는 코드와 지식을 재사용하여 향후 테마를 보다 빠르고 쉽게 만들 수 있습니다.

워드프레스 테마는 웹사이트를 디자인하고 기능하는 데 사용되는 파일입니다. 많은 테마에는 웹사이트의 모양을 빠르고 쉽게 변경할 수 있는 다양한 옵션이 있습니다. WordPress 테마는 자신의 목적, 클라이언트 프로젝트 또는 WordPress 테마 디렉토리 에 제출하는 데 사용할 수 있습니다. 스타일시트는 테마에 대한 정보를 제공하기 위해 주석을 포함해야 합니다. 두 개의 테마에 동일한 주석 헤더가 있는 경우 테마 선택 대화 상자에 문제가 있기 때문에 하나 이상의 테마에 동일한 세부 정보가 있을 수 없습니다. Functions.php는 테마 이름의 하위 디렉터리이며 함수 파일을 만드는 데 사용할 수 있습니다. 다양한 템플릿 중에서 선택하여 다양한 기능을 갖춘 사이트를 만들 수 있습니다.

각 테마의 템플릿 계층 구조는 테마에서 사용 가능한 템플릿에 따라 사용할 템플릿과 템플릿 생성 방법을 결정합니다. 템플릿은 index.html 마스터 파일에 정의되어 있으므로 페이지가 생성될 때 표시할 위치에 이러한 다른 파일을 포함할 수 있습니다. 각 템플릿과 관련된 모든 파일은 Themes 디렉토리에서 찾을 수 있습니다. 새 사용자 정의 페이지 템플릿을 생성하려면 먼저 파일을 생성해야 합니다. 템플릿 이름을 변경하려면 슬라브어를 원하는 텍스트로 바꾸십시오. 이 템플릿 이름은 테마 편집기에 이 파일을 편집할 수 있는 링크로 표시됩니다. 템플릿 계층을 사용하려면 먼저 특수 목적 템플릿 파일 세트를 제공해야 합니다.

카테고리가 표시되면 이러한 파일을 사용하여 index.php를 재정의합니다. 사용자 정의 기준에 따라 정의할 수 있는 추가 템플릿 이 있습니다. 이 고급 기능은 template_include 작업 후크를 사용하여 수행할 수 있습니다. 이제 WordPress 3.4부터 거의 모든 WordPress 테마에 대해 새로운 테마 사용자 정의 기능을 사용할 수 있습니다. 이 기능을 통해 관리자는 실시간으로 이루어진 비영구적 변경 사항을 미리 볼 수 있습니다. bloginfo() 함수를 사용하면 다른 파일의 URI 및 파일 경로를 사용하여 동일한 테마의 다른 파일을 참조할 수 있습니다. WordPress 코딩 표준에 따르면 속성을 입력하는 텍스트는 esc_attr()을 사용하여 실행하여 작은따옴표나 큰따옴표가 속성 값을 끝내고 XHTML을 무효화하지 않도록 해야 합니다.

제목, 대체 및 값 속성은 모두 시작하기에 좋은 위치입니다. i18n 기능을 사용하여 템플릿 파일 내의 모든 번역 가능한 텍스트를 줄 바꿈할 수 있습니다. 이 때문에 번역 파일을 연결하고 레이블, 제목 및 기타 템플릿 텍스트를 사이트의 현재 언어로 번역하기가 더 쉽습니다. 이미지는 너비 1200x600dpi, 높이 900x900dpi를 권장합니다. 결과적으로 스크린샷은 HiDPI 디스플레이에서 작게 표시되지만 이미지가 클수록 더 잘 볼 수 있습니다. 이 기능을 수행하는 기능은 버전 3.0 이후 WordPress Multisite 설치의 경우 기본적으로 관리자 역할에 할당되지 않았습니다.